This briefing summarises trailing-year performance across our three regions. Ashmere exceeded plan by a modest margin, driven by repeat orders from mid-market accounts. Dravenport fell short, largely due to delayed onboarding of two senior reps and a softer industrial segment. Westholme remains steady but shows early signs of saturation. Management proposes reallocating quota and support resources ahead of the next cycle. The strategic implications of these findings are set out in the confidential note below.

management briefing: Project Ulavan slips by two quarters because of the staffing delay.

Your invalidation hook fires on every catalog write, which will stampede the Orchardline cache under bulk imports. Batch the keys and debounce instead. Also: plugins must not call `purgeAll` directly — use the scoped invalidator so unrelated vendors' entries survive. TTL jitter is mandatory; without it, synchronized expiry took down staging twice last quarter. Respect the negative-cache window for deleted SKUs or you'll thrash the origin. The limits your plugin must stay within are set by the constants below.

constants for tafog-kahag:
RATE_LIMITS = {
    "sorir": 697,
    "oliox": 683,
    "holax": 176,
    "casox": 60,
    "pelius": 382,
}

Duplicate detection switched from title matching to normalized identifier hashing, cutting false merges by an estimated 90%. Import throughput improved to ~12k records/minute on the Harrowfield staging cluster. One known gap: serials with irregular volume numbering still need manual review. Questions about the quarantine workflow go to the engineer named below.

named custodian: Oliath Ralax